Helicopter retention plate hardware stand
Abstract
A standardized hardware stand for organizing the components and subcomponents of helicopter retention plates is provided. The hardware stand could be adapted to be distributed to all air stations so that a repeatable, teachable skill set can be developed, minimizing costly vibratory analysis, problematic clamp-up procedures, and other unnecessary additional maintenance during re-installation of the helicopter retention plates. The hardware stand includes a mock plate forming a plurality of mimicking holes and identifying marks, each dimensioned and adapted to match that of each retention plate maintained, and wherein the mock plate is perpendicularly and rotatably joined to an attachments stem.
